🧼 The Golden Rules of Washing

  1. Ditch the dry brush. This is the #1 law. Want a frizzy cloud instead of defined spirals? No? Then only detangle your hair when it’s soaking wet and loaded with product.
  2. Hydration is everything. Afro curls are naturally thirstier. After washing, always use a conditioner. Apply it to soaking wet hair, comb through with your fingers, and rinse—but leave a little bit in for that "slippery" feel.
  3. The "Squish." Gently scrunch your hair upwards toward the scalp to help the curls "remember" their shape.

✂️ The Cut Matters

To keep Afro curls from looking like a shapeless bush, the right silhouette is key.

  • Short & Sharp: If you prefer a shorter look, keep more length on top. Curls need "room" to actually spiral.
  • Longer Styles:
  1. Classic One-Length: Bold, masculine, and timeless.
  2. The Cascade: Perfect for distributing volume so the shape doesn't get too "boxy."
  3. With Bangs (Fringe): Adds a mysterious, high-fashion edge to the look.
  4. The Mullet: For the creative souls. An Afro-mullet is a total showstopper!
